Thundercontent review

Thundercontent pitches itself as an all-in-one AI content platform rather than a single writing feature. That can be useful for buyers who want one dashboard for text and voice work, but all-in-one tools often win on convenience before they win on quality, so the practical test is still output reliability.

Thundercontent publicly advertises a free-to-try path and a pricing page built around an all-in-one content generator model, but the page parser does not surface a clean full price table in search. Public software directories commonly cite pricing around $19 to $39 per month depending on billing, so treat the product as low-to-mid-priced and confirm the live checkout before relying on exact numbers.


Best for smaller teams and marketers who want one account for text plus voice features. Less suitable for buyers who need highly transparent pricing or specialist best-in-class tools for each content format.


Does Thundercontent have a free option?

It advertises a free-to-try starting point, which makes it easier to test than some content suites.

Is Thundercontent mainly a writing tool?

Not only. It also pushes voice and broader content-workflow features.

Is the pricing perfectly transparent from public snippets?

No. Buyers should verify the live plan page before assuming exact monthly costs.
